Utilizing Written Agreements to Clarify Expectations

Utilizing written agreements to clarify expectations is a fundamental component of effective client management in legal practice. Clear, concise documentation helps establish mutual understanding and reduces potential disputes. It provides a concrete reference point for both attorneys and clients regarding the scope and responsibilities of the engagement.

A well-drafted agreement should include key elements such as scope of services, estimated timelines, fee arrangements, and communication protocols. Explicitly detailing these aspects minimizes ambiguity and aligns client expectations with realistic outcomes. This transparency fosters trust and discourages misunderstandings.

When effectively executed, written agreements serve as a proactive measure to manage client expectations. They clarify what can and cannot be achieved, setting appropriate boundaries from the outset. Incorporating clear expectations in formal documentation is particularly important in complex legal matters where uncertainty may arise.

  • Define the scope of legal services to be provided
  • Specify expected timelines and milestones
  • Outline fee structures and billing practices
  • Establish communication channels and update procedures

Utilizing written agreements to clarify expectations ensures all parties are aligned, contributing to a smoother legal process and improved client satisfaction.

Documenting Client Communications Effectively

Effective documentation of client communications is fundamental to managing client expectations successfully. It creates a clear record of discussions, agreements, and expectations, reducing misunderstandings and conflicts. Proper documentation promotes transparency and accountability within legal practice.

Key practices include maintaining organized records of all written communications, such as emails, letters, and notes from meetings or phone calls. Using date stamps, summaries, and relevant details ensures these records are comprehensive and accessible. This systematic approach supports consistent follow-up and clarifies expectations.

Implementing a structured way to document communications involves a few essential steps:

  • Keeping detailed notes during client interactions.
  • Sending follow-up emails summarizing key points and agreements.
  • Storing all correspondence securely within client files.
  • Utilizing case management software to track communication history.

By documenting client communications effectively, legal professionals can avoid disputes, reinforce trust, and ensure that managing client expectations is both transparent and professionally handled.

Leveraging Technology to Keep Clients Informed

Leveraging technology plays a vital role in managing client expectations effectively by facilitating real-time communication and transparency. Legal professionals can utilize secure client portals, email updates, and instant messaging platforms to keep clients consistently informed about case progress. This approach helps clients understand developments promptly, reducing uncertainty and anxiety.

Additionally, case management software enables attorneys to schedule automatic updates and generate comprehensive reports, ensuring that information is accurate and current. Over time, these tools streamline communication workflows, making expectation management more efficient and professional. It also minimizes miscommunication risks and reinforces transparency, which is essential in legal practice.

Finally, leveraging technology for client engagement includes virtual consultations and secure video conferencing, accommodating clients’ schedules and preferences. These tools foster ongoing dialogue, allowing clients to ask questions and express concerns in a timely manner. Overall, adopting technological solutions significantly enhances the clarity and consistency necessary for managing client expectations effectively.
